Safety
Bunk beds are a great option for families who live in small spaces or who have several children. Bunk beds are an excellent option to make room in a bedroom because they offer two beds in one. However, safety should always be a priority. Children must be monitored at all times while sleeping on the top bunk and it is crucial to teach them about safety in bed to avoid injuries. There are numerous safety features available for bunk beds, including guard rails as well as sturdy ladders and solid frames. These safety measures help to avoid injuries and accidents that may result from falls, entrapment and structural failure.
Guard rails on the top bunk are a crucial safety measure, and should be at least five inches higher than the mattress and extend over the entire length of the upper bed. These rails must be made of durable solid and secure materials. They should not have gaps that could cause children to fall. Rails should be firmly connected to bunk bed frames. Ladders and steps should be constructed of durable materials that are smooth or recessed and don't have sharp edges, sharp points or dangers of snags.
Children should be taught that bunk beds are primarily for sleeping purposes and should not be used as play areas. It is important to teach children how to use the ladder in a safe and secure manner and only to climb it when they are sleeping. It is also essential to ensure that they don't hang anything on the guard rails of the top bunk since it could be a source of strangulation. This includes belts and scarves as well as jump ropes and other decorations.
Solid frames are an additional component of bunk bed security. They should be constructed from quality wood and have solid connections. Metal-on-metal connections are a great method to ensure longevity and that they won't loosen over time. They should also be properly constructed and regularly checked to ensure they are strong. It is also recommended to choose only mattresses of the highest quality, since they are less likely to get damaged over time.

Style
A bunk bed can be a stylish and enjoyable way for kids to sleep and play with each other. You can select from a wide selection of designs to find one that fits the room of your child. You should also make sure your bunk bed complies with safety guidelines and instructions that are provided by the manufacturer to ensure a safe and sturdy structure.
Standard bunk beds come with two twin-sized beds stacked on top of each other and are perfect for siblings who share the same room. Low-rise bunks are ideal for a minimalist look. They're just 50 inches high and have guard rails at the top. Consider a bed with a high rise for your kids if they like a bit more height. This type of bunk offers more privacy on the upper level, and features an integrated staircase or ladder that makes it easier to get up and back down.
Corner lofts or bunk beds are another great option for saving space and allowing each child to have their own space to sleep. The perpendicular design gives you plenty of space under for a reading space or playroom, as well as additional storage. Bunk beds are available in a range of finishes and materials, to allow you to customize the appearance to fit your child's bedroom decor.
